Re: 0% for 60 months [mazda6dude] by rik4
Feb 05, 2009 (5:26 pm)
Reply

Replying to: mazda6dude (Feb 05, 2009 7:15 am)

yes you are corect on the 0% or 2750 off for the 2009 but look at this absurd deal on the left over 2008. 2750 same rebate but 3.9% instead. this makes no sense you should always try and get riid of old inventory before new. who in their right mind would pay more for a 2008 than a 2009. well the squirrels at gm do. no wonder they are in the shape they are. they should check their desk drawers for illegal drugs too. that would be a valid reason for this absurd deal.
